pub struct UpdatePlanExecutionStepFluentBuilder { /* private fields */ }
Expand description
Fluent builder constructing a request to UpdatePlanExecutionStep
.
Updates a specific step in an in-progress plan execution. This operation allows you to modify the step's comment or action.

Sourcepub async fn send(
self,
) -> Result<UpdatePlanExecutionStepOutput, SdkError<UpdatePlanExecutionStepError, HttpResponse>>
pub async fn send( self, ) -> Result<UpdatePlanExecutionStepOutput, SdkError<UpdatePlanExecutionStepError, HttpResponse>>
Sends the request and returns the response.
If an error occurs, an SdkError
will be returned with additional details that
can be matched against.
By default, any retryable failures will be retried twice. Retry behavior is configurable with the RetryConfig, which can be set when configuring the client.
